  • Welcome to the Biomedical Systems Engineering Lab!

     

    We associate the principles and knowledge of process systems engineering with advanced experimental techniques to provide solutions to biological and medical problems.

     

     


    The BSEL uses an interdisciplinary approach to provide integrated in vitro/in silico platforms for clinically translational applications. Through mammalian and stem cell bioprocessing, tissue engineering, and microbial population dynamics, BSEL focuses in precision anti-cancer treatment platforms, cellular therapies, and monoclonal antibody production technologies
